Output ed77aa28e3e925dfb059d54878825981b98a2893907f38f73e9178c3c369e62b:0

value
18095239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b034710c129c799847a006d6e825cae970a452b OP_EQUAL
address
MQwzX2vtC97Xs9LRBeV4CcHg5ap6yXnjqf
transaction
ed77aa28e3e925dfb059d54878825981b98a2893907f38f73e9178c3c369e62b
spent
true